General note:Edited by Albertus de Placentia and Augustinus de Casali Maiori.
Full-page woodcut architectural border on leaf A1v, repeated on a1v, each border enclosing a different black-ground woodcut ill. (that on A1v depicts the author presenting his work to Beatrice of Aragon); a different full-page woodcut border on a2r; 172 woodcuts (including repeats, from 56 blocks) of famous women in text. (WorldCat)
ISTC title: De claris mulieribus.
Leaf numbers CLIX, CXXII are duplicated.
Signatures: A⁴ a-e⁸ f⁶ g-p⁸ q-x⁶·⁸ y-z⁶.
The caption title on A2r exists in two states. In one state, the caption title is printed on three lines; in another state, the final word ("Prologus.") is printed separately in a fourth line. (WorldCat)
Woodcut capitals.
Woodcut title (A1r)
